Church by the Glades may easily be described as unconventional, but the church has a not-so-hidden secret. Monday through Friday, about one third of the campus is transformed from Megachurch to modest school. From a fully-licensed preschool and VPK to a middle school equipped with iPads and e-textbooks, Glades Christian Academy and Preschool is home to approximately 240 students from 6 weeks old through the 8th grade.

The large, beautiful campus is somewhat deceiving. You might expect it to house a hustling, bustling school of a thousand or more. While the education is as exceptional as larger schools, the experience feels more like family. Warm smiles, small class sizes, and close knit student groups abound at GCA. While the curriculum is time-tested and well established, the principal and staff are empowered to think outside of the box. Parents aren’t just called when students are in trouble or failing, but also to celebrate or just to check in and find out how things are going.

Founded in 1991, Glades Christian Academy sees students graduating from its eighth grade class who have been at the school for many years. There are also many siblings attending together.
